A woman who carried out two assaults will appear in court again next month.
Victoria Jane Ross of Ballaradcliffe in Andreas was excused appearing before magistrates at Douglas Courthouse because of Covid restrictions.
The 31 year old pleaded guilty to the two assaults on a woman - which happened on September 15 last year - at an earlier hearing.
Magistrates bailed her and she'll appear in court again on May 13.
